ちょっとMonoDevelopをいじる必要があったので、ついでにmldsp-gtkにMIDIデバイスセレクタを追加して、スペアナ付きの機能追加バージョンとしてリリースすることにした。downloads / web
相変わらず重いのだけど、0.1を試してみたらやはり重かったので、バージョンアップによる効果というより、そもそもmoonlightが重いようだ。
さて。
mldspに限らず、今作っているコードの多くは、組み合わせて利用するようになるだろうと思っている。mldspにはキーボード等の入力を反映し(mmk)、音色パッチエディタを組み込み、テキストから命令を一括送信する(mugene)機能が追加されるだろう。現在でもSMFを読み書きするライブラリ(SMF.cs)は、全てのライブラリで共通して使用されているが、全て手動でコピーしている。これは共有するようにした方が好ましいだろう。
mldspをメインにした統合アプリケーションを実現する予定は今のところ無いのだけど、そういうアプリケーションが多々出現する理由が何となく分かった気がする。
そんなわけで、そのうちgithub上にあるモジュールを全部一緒にすることになるかもしれない。
Leave a comment